🎓 Course Description: Our “Advanced Training in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y” course offers an in-depth exploration of advanced concepts and techniques in CBT. Designed for mental health professionals seeking to enhance their skills, this course delves into sophisticated strategies for addressing complex psychological issues using evidence-based CBT principles.
🔍 Course Content Highlights:
- Advanced CBT Theory: Delve deeper into the theoretical foundations of CBT, including cognitive restructuring, behavioral activation, and the integration of mindfulness techniques.
- Complex Case Studies: Analyze and develop treatment plans for intricate case studies, covering a range of mental health disorders such as anxiety disorders, depression, personality disorders, and more.
- Cognitive Restructuring Techniques: Learn advanced methods for identifying and challenging maladaptive thought patterns, including schema-focused techniques and cognitive reappraisal strategies.
- Behavioral Experiments: Explore sophisticated behavioral experiments to test and modify dysfunctional beliefs and behaviors, fostering lasting change in clients.
- Mindfulness Integration: Discover how to seamlessly integrate mindfulness-based approaches into CBT interventions, enhancing clients’ self-awareness and emotional regulation skills.
- Cultural Competence in CBT: Understand the importance of cultural factors in therapy and develop culturally sensitive CBT interventions to effectively address the needs of diverse populations.
- Supervision and Consultation: Receive guidance and feedback through supervision sessions, enhancing your clinical skills and competence in delivering advanced CBT interventions.
